Our lives have meaning and purpose, both now and in eternity. What we do now affects our experience in eternity. God, as revealed by Jesus, has given us general guidance. God has created us to have individual needs, hopes, fears, abilities, callings, and dreams. And we find ourselves immersed in a world of free will, both our own and that of others. Our goal is to find our individual purposes and to pursue them in the face of threats, challenges, diversions, and opportunities in our short lives.

A local church is an assembly of individuals who help one another find and pursue God’s will. Individuals together can pray, learn, encourage, plan, and implement in ways that would be impossible alone. Spreading news about Jesus, doing his work, experiencing his blessings, and experiencing fulfillment in life is greatly enhanced by community. Our commitment is to make love tangible, practical, and available to all who gather with us. We believe God’s promise is to share abundance in this life and to welcome us into eternal life when we die.

Our goals in 2011 are to provide Saturday worship for those unable to gather on Sunday mornings, to expand our prayer, youth, mission, drama, music, Christian education, and kitchen ministries, and to increase our positive impact on Quakertown as a Quakertown Church.
